Whats the slope of (-2,4) and (1,-2)

Respuesta :

theaisaho
theaisaho theaisaho
  • 25-03-2020

Answer:

slope = -2

Step-by-step explanation:

If you use the slope formula (m=y2-y1/x2-x1) and plug in the points, you get m = -2
